Average Radiation Therapists Salary in Harrisburg-Carlisle, PA

The average salary for Radiation Therapistss in Harrisburg-Carlisle, PA is $98,320. While this is lower than the national average, the cost of living in Harrisburg-Carlisle, PA may offset the difference, preserving real purchasing power.

Executive Summary

  • Average Salary: $98,320 per year.
  • Growth Trend: Salaries have shifted 1.4% over the last 5 years.
  • Top Earners: Senior professionals (90th percentile) earn up to $123,530.
  • Outlook: The current demand for Radiation Therapistss is stable, with a local workforce of approximately 50 professionals. This role remains a specialized component of the broader Harrisburg-Carlisle, PA economy.

Radiation Therapists Salary Distribution in Harrisburg-Carlisle, PA

The earning potential for Radiation Therapistss in Harrisburg-Carlisle, PA varies significantly by experience level. The salary gap is relatively narrow, suggesting consistent and predictable earnings from entry-level to senior positions. Entry-level roles (10th percentile) typically start around $78,070, while highly experienced professionals can command wages upwards of $123,530.

Frequently Asked Questions

How much does a Radiation Therapists make in Harrisburg-Carlisle, PA?

The median annual salary for a Radiation Therapists in Harrisburg-Carlisle, PA is $98,320. This typically ranges from $78,070 for entry-level positions to $123,530 for top-level roles.

How does the salary compare to the national average?

The average salary for this role in Harrisburg-Carlisle, PA is 10.9% lower than the national median of $110,350.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 50 employees in the Harrisburg-Carlisle, PA area with a job density of 0.144 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
